About the Role

This is an excellent opportunity for an experienced compliance professional to take ownership of core compliance and governance activity within a friendly and values-driven organisation. Working independently but collaboratively, you will help maintain the compliance, governance and risk frameworks, ensuring they continue to operate with integrity and meet all regulatory expectations.

In this varied role, you will:

  • Compliance & Risk Oversight
    • Maintain and update key compliance registers, including risk, gifts and hospitality, conflicts, complaints and breaches.
    • Coordinate the risk management cycle, ensuring consistent monitoring and accurate reporting.
    • Deliver scheduled internal audits and reviews, presenting findings clearly and driving follow-up actions.
    • Monitor regulatory changes and translate requirements into practical guidance for colleagues.
    • Support AML/KYC processes and provide informed advice to teams.
  • Governance & Policy Management
    • Review and update internal policies to ensure compliance and alignment with best practice.
    • Produce clear, well-structured reports, dashboards and papers for senior leadership and committees.
    • Support the administration of governance committees, including preparing agendas, taking minutes and tracking agreed actions.
  • Insurance & Procurement Assurance
    • Coordinate annual insurance renewals, assist with claims, and maintain strong relationships with brokers and insurers.
    • Provide oversight of procurement activity, ensuring supplier due diligence and adherence to policy.
  • Quality, Health, Safety & Environmental (QHSE)
    • Support QHSE documentation, audits and incident reporting processes.
  • Stakeholder Support & Culture
    • Build trusted relationships across the organisation to embed a strong compliance culture.
    • Deliver light-touch compliance training and briefings.
    • Offer practical, timely advice to teams seeking guidance.

About You

We are looking for someone who brings:

  • Experience in a compliance, governance or risk-focused role.
  • A strong understanding of compliance frameworks, internal controls and regulatory responsibilities.
  • Confidence in conducting audits or reviews and presenting clear findings.
  • Excellent organisational skills and the ability to manage a varied workload independently.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to work effectively with colleagues at all levels.
  • High levels of discretion, sound judgement and professional integrity.
  • Solid Microsoft Office skills and the ability to produce high-quality written reports.

Desirable:

  • A compliance-related qualification (ICA, IRM, CGI/ICSA).
  • Experience in professional services, property, charity or similar sectors.
  • Understanding of AML, data protection, risk methodologies or QHSE frameworks.
